Epidemics

Delve into the profound impact of infectious diseases with "Epidemics" by H. Phillips, Ph.D. Published in 2012, this compelling book spans 168 pages and meticulously examines five of the most devastating epidemics from 1713 to the present: smallpox, bubonic plague, Spanish influenza, polio, and HIV/AIDS. Phillips explores the origins of these diseases, their catastrophic progression, and the far-reaching consequences they have had on society both in the immediate aftermath and over the long term. With a unique historical perspective, this book is essential for anyone interested in disease history, public health, and the role of epidemics in shaping human experiences.
